Change SockJS and Websocket default allowedOrigins to same origin
This commit adds support for a same origin check that compares Origin header to Host header. It also changes the default setting from all origins allowed to only same origin allowed. Issues: SPR-12697, SPR-12685

==== Configuring allowed origins
|
||||
|
||||
As of Spring Framework 4.1.5, Websocket and SockJS default behavior is to accept only same
|
||||
origin requests. It is also possible to allow all or a specified list of origins.
|
||||
This check is mostly designed for browser clients. There is nothing preventing other types
|
||||
of client to modify the `Origin` header value (see
|
||||
https://tools.ietf.org/html/rfc6454[RFC 6454: The Web Origin Concept] for more details).
|
||||
|
||||
The 3 possible behaviors are:
|
||||
|
||||
* Allow only same origin requests (default): in this mode, when SockJS is enabled, the
|
||||
Iframe HTTP response header `X-Frame-Options` is set to `SAMEORIGIN`, and JSONP
|
||||
transport is disabled since it does not allow to check the origin of a request.
|
||||
As a consequence, IE6 and IE7 are not supported when this mode is enabled.
|
||||
* Allow a specified list of origins: each provided allowed origin must start by `http://`
|
||||
or `https://`. In this mode, when SockJS is enabled, both IFrame and JSONP based
|
||||
transports are disabled. As a consequence, IE6 up to IE9 are not supported when this
|
||||
mode is enabled.
|
||||
* Allow all origins: to enable this mode, you should provide `*` as allowed origin. In this
|
||||
mode, all transports are available.
|
||||
|
